The A/C in the truck works sometimes. On initial startup it works. It works when I am driving. However if I get into traffic (stop and go) it stops working. Also if I stop for gas or at a store it doesn't work on starting the truck. Normally if I can drive several miles it starts working again.
I have concluded that not enough air is passing thru the condenser. I think there is a problem with the pusher fan mounted to the condenser. When the motor is on the fan is turning but slowly, I thing the air being pulled past it by the engine fan is causing it to turn. With the engine off and the ignition and A/C on it doesn't turn. My question is should this fan run continuously when the A/C is turned on or is it on some type of switch (such as a temperature or pressure switch) that turns it on and off as needed?
